Here is what to know about the documentary and how to watch it:In the dark of the early, early morning of Aug. 26, 1980, a nondescript white van drove across the street from South Lake Tahoe, California to Stateline, Nevada. It parked in front of the Harvey's Resort and Casino, one of the largest, most well-known casinos in the Tahoe corridor.Two men wheeled out a device the size of an IBM copier and wheeled it up to the door, struggling with the weight, only to have the security guard hold the door open and help them hold open the elevator. In the show, the house was supposed to be set in Ossining, NY, which highlights one of the reasons that Pasadena is such a desirable filming location: with its wealth of different architectural styles and vegetation, Pasadena can stand in for almost anywhere. They took the device to the second floor, wheeled it into the business office and met a third man who helped them take the cover off.What followed was 36 hours where the entire casino loop was evacuated, bomb squads were called in, and one of the largest explosions to hit any city in Nevada or California rocked the small community.What led up to the explosion and what happened afterward is the kind of story no one would believe if you wrote it up as fiction.
